2. What is Viagra?

Viagra (sildenafil citrate) is a prescription medication used to treat erectile dysfunction (ED) in men. It works by increasing blood flow to the penis, which helps men achieve and maintain an erection during sexual activity. Viagra is available in three doses: 25 mg, 50 mg, and 100 mg tablets. Your doctor will determine which dose is right for you based on your medical history, other medications you are taking, and other factors.

4. Is it safe to take two Viagra pills?

It is generally not recommended that you take two Viagra pills at once due to the potential side effects and risks associated with taking too much sildenafil citrate at once. Taking more than one pill can lead to an increased risk of experiencing serious side effects such as headaches, chest pain, dizziness, blurred vision, nausea, irregular heartbeat or fainting spells. Additionally, taking too much sildenafil citrate could potentially cause a dangerous drop in blood pressure which could lead to serious health complications if left untreated.

Can you take two Viagra pills in the same day?
No you should not take Viagra more than once a day. The maximum recommended frequency is once per day and the maximum dose is 100 mg per day. If you have any questions about using Viagra for your pain talk to your doctor.
